Abstract

BIPV modules have many advantages, but they are expensive to install, so it is important to increase the persistence of BIPV modules. To increase the durability of the BIPV module, one of the key components, the encapsulant, was changed to extend the life of the BIPV module and measure the efficiency. Because the core elements of the BIPV module and the PV module are the same, the output before and after deterioration of the PV module made of each encapsulant was compared.
